nnpf

View on PyPIReverse Dependencies (0)

1.0.2 nnpf-1.0.2-py3-none-any.whl

Wheel Details

Project: nnpf
Version: 1.0.2
Filename: nnpf-1.0.2-py3-none-any.whl
Download: [link]
Size: 84191
MD5: b8e86b4a412998d4034d59dcf8b210d2
SHA256: 19822eb54168c8d0f2dbfbd97b143ce85a44104142388624595ee2072d96a0c8
Uploaded: 2024-10-22 14:32:54 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: nnpf
Version: 1.0.2
Summary: Neural Network for Phase-Field models
Author-Email: Roland Denis <denis[at]math.univ-lyon1.fr>, Garry Terii <terii[at]math.univ-lyon1.fr>
Maintainer-Email: Roland Denis <denis[at]math.univ-lyon1.fr>
Project-Url: homepage, https://github.com/PhaseFieldICJ/nnpf
Project-Url: repository, https://github.com/PhaseFieldICJ/nnpf
Project-Url: Bug Tracker, https://github.com/PhaseFieldICJ/nnpf/issues
Keywords: phase field,mean curvature,neural network
Classifier: Development Status :: 5 - Production/Stable
Classifier: Programming Language :: Python :: 3
Classifier: Operating System :: OS Independent
Classifier: License :: OSI Approved :: MIT License
Classifier: Intended Audience :: Science/Research
Classifier: Topic :: Scientific/Engineering :: Mathematics
Classifier: Topic :: Scientific/Engineering :: Artificial Intelligence
Requires-Python: >=3.8
Requires-Dist: numpy (<2)
Requires-Dist: matplotlib
Requires-Dist: torch (<=1.12.1,>=1.10.0)
Requires-Dist: torchvision (>=0.8.1)
Requires-Dist: torchmetrics (<0.8.0)
Requires-Dist: pytorch-lightning (==1.4.5)
Requires-Dist: tensorboard (<2.12)
Requires-Dist: tqdm
Requires-Dist: imageio
Requires-Dist: imageio-ffmpeg
Requires-Dist: torchinfo
Requires-Dist: pytest
Description-Content-Type: text/markdown
License-File: LICENSE.md
[Description omitted; length: 4750 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.2.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
nnpf/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
nnpf/__main__.py sha256=Ks_1GyKjJBQLerkBX9hL99TL1TqrfsuOCQzFp4uaOpc 123
nnpf/cmd/__init__.py sha256=GbODtxlYN5X43M_GIekgFu3xvKWfjucA_tNsReYoan8 2151
nnpf/cmd/bench.py sha256=x-IxtDFOVJXSmpYp0VGECpOvW-8DUk7l61CO3ezhF40 5330
nnpf/cmd/infos.py sha256=Tl5SNrzSKlEil9fpWy95q7m4JffM66ucD0qZQqVWKlc 1849
nnpf/cmd/selftest.py sha256=PdDOu0uWUhVk4DMc082DKCk7HKTqIdT7W3W1whVLTMo 854
nnpf/cmd/train.py sha256=ynVIC2hHwNpPGxJJcSU0OGByMfNyaGYKIQ5BUXmnzwI 3635
nnpf/datasets/__init__.py sha256=AnGr7U0na00HC37P4BDTtuvwWvxXRtvQAO_Gq-DIYaY 28
nnpf/datasets/phase_field.py sha256=yxrOQS9uj9p65RXQuoPVQN5g5CJ6ySqTUax2dK3NwCM 3817
nnpf/domain/__init__.py sha256=TCHeQCNvWQtbMMsh_9nJ_DWubTP5f_UB9L_HSFac7b4 22
nnpf/domain/domain.py sha256=Xh4nIoPX_YQW_juU3ZDz3r5atLClFlKvoCw0rUUScKg 7114
nnpf/fft/__init__.py sha256=0L7jdw6WkTvRnO-EaCSv-lJMErXLMiWpeGhWPNEETvU 46
nnpf/fft/domain.py sha256=3gKDyMCXON6T-L3HzaoKIYBrc0l3h8RfhPks9YnDCoI 3729
nnpf/fft/toolbox.py sha256=7m9ZrxJLgUBRJ-Mi3jI5EEnt7cDFSfpNAqhQsdN3g_M 6009
nnpf/functional/__init__.py sha256=HQRJ_A3-ravWwMCJJ3cY8Z6FeccGMendpZiKqa5eIRs 115
nnpf/functional/heat.py sha256=Ya21ralDlwNND4z4rhzK2pNXL4agoHmTpTNBm4uhIAc 1393
nnpf/functional/norms.py sha256=ScXweZoz-K9pRvq1N9o8rMdMlmz08lqkW6a6mtYAmqo 2329
nnpf/functional/operators.py sha256=EErrFIkXY7dnRKHK4Ltd5H-2N4ub2HV-HkUo4HpxpKU 7164
nnpf/functional/phase_field.py sha256=94M5ugBJs-WCeAdqxpsUXs6kYl7A_08ptYrroEioi8Q 2731
nnpf/functional/utils.py sha256=GIh6x5uO2fUVY3vykbfqMTQ0U77TyzoFVJ01phxm93w 2684
nnpf/io/__init__.py sha256=LrDTdgzbtRLoreRf6hvWWxiUGFhtHeX5vlu8GJxHM_Y 47
nnpf/io/tensorboard.py sha256=gBoz3Lug4MHYo1y4dOO8mJcr7mjrEICqcz4zhyfaARg 2359
nnpf/io/vtk.py sha256=-IgkhUZIBFJcUnWHcwHu0ZRQBcJbOn6ltaUcZxdB--A 1789
nnpf/models/__init__.py sha256=ZeOG9ATUrbdaFc1rI8sMRC0_RJr68zOsj0M37zcRHc8 87
nnpf/models/allen_cahn_splitting.py sha256=colEpq_pQV2-FcYlz9TZhMbuz5GXkAPh5-8KzMJp6ss 5262
nnpf/models/heat_array.py sha256=UY5DH98L-mml1GrqiVqb9clbCFzhJIExfDqwKLDQOrE 5121
nnpf/models/reaction.py sha256=pIQ407Xan44uUCo3JI3B_n6QpfA7P0eQCK_-7KtYbk4 2458
nnpf/nn/__init__.py sha256=ouh35Wu-KgmhD5nz4o0Xeq2LBhb70uRRXuidUZ5cvns 63
nnpf/nn/conv.py sha256=aJQ7FkoA6i1SPlprb2IpezXjtN5LLbtwd113aZsHTBk 10142
nnpf/nn/models.py sha256=ZsNekvv_HKz-FosOGBMIY4Fla_2LlFosKP1z0X7zWy0 3699
nnpf/nn/utils.py sha256=BpYPaW6kP03V3CCQ_cVH1jy_jfAgt2cOk29HmOBYUMM 10411
nnpf/problems/__init__.py sha256=ERvyIYdI8TmsZJfvOYsAZKZ_dow6u4ScqasICJUXJvs 256
nnpf/problems/problem.py sha256=TTVvUWWqvFBk0DsUIqb_Q07zW8Kiu-kml7Z5TxLmTzI 5200
nnpf/problems/allen_cahn/__init__.py sha256=i2VWh-2QsIMffF3hxqU-ZK5Y0iauO1QH_PKV2CWnDCU 69
nnpf/problems/allen_cahn/datasets.py sha256=vj5NCBv9SIA_-VQwcgcm0xja7l-uSZKFkrz-ldaVIcs 972
nnpf/problems/allen_cahn/problem.py sha256=3SBxuXpYn_bxQif9Gv01mzyj_WGaFHckW9LXF9AIMls 1576
nnpf/problems/allen_cahn/utils.py sha256=e4DtAl3agAaWACpbIxgEpW_w-zDGxNRxn4hdwmO6Wao 477
nnpf/problems/heat/__init__.py sha256=wFqT1hhImsTU2aUgM8Q3or6OTRfSQvDzE5NXwtjjB_Y 72
nnpf/problems/heat/datasets.py sha256=JtTEvBZRoHz7hBBp7Sxfqdu0FlzQl_SVsOkpFwnSHMw 1654
nnpf/problems/heat/problem.py sha256=9TkLywIG8480KAsOR6n4Zt3MXHD28QUpidUPvuVO8_I 8114
nnpf/problems/heat/solution.py sha256=T6boqSfzskLX8mtf0MOhppHn6bNKNaxzskMSPb38OuY 685
nnpf/problems/mean_curvature/__init__.py sha256=i2VWh-2QsIMffF3hxqU-ZK5Y0iauO1QH_PKV2CWnDCU 69
nnpf/problems/mean_curvature/datasets.py sha256=VWCJicbs_MVc3wu6mbvlq6yR2mbnENf4EZt05ZWKmUk 7441
nnpf/problems/mean_curvature/problem.py sha256=7UakxI0MJiwEZ5ZRHBOuqQv74OZlU80VvZirJpug44A 13371
nnpf/problems/mean_curvature/utils.py sha256=OL0PKmWG4W3yrkDwJQVx6_51My_xLA2KrcNzC-2Ba5s 2814
nnpf/problems/reaction/__init__.py sha256=wFqT1hhImsTU2aUgM8Q3or6OTRfSQvDzE5NXwtjjB_Y 72
nnpf/problems/reaction/datasets.py sha256=ikQeywj7ox0tzNhzeMyZCo4asfJ-YO5N_kGoSjc1ptI 1238
nnpf/problems/reaction/problem.py sha256=dKeDo0_hSttb2nx2f8ON7XXTHw4FrVp-LS26AM6rrzY 4944
nnpf/problems/reaction/solution.py sha256=F_qWBo39WlDZ32hdrIaHKXg3Z0sfwcPpEqzGyiN_C6w 1020
nnpf/problems/steiner/__init__.py sha256=i2VWh-2QsIMffF3hxqU-ZK5Y0iauO1QH_PKV2CWnDCU 69
nnpf/problems/steiner/datasets.py sha256=pZBTkbvP-P_kY5hovW0dz9lYsz0ez4xWJM3giYT7TVA 991
nnpf/problems/steiner/problem.py sha256=_OG7_1Dou_xZcJ1pb5IjJ8ldnJ8vxg-DP1YJltQu5j4 1549
nnpf/problems/steiner/utils.py sha256=WP71syF3GMdwxHEWKqEPT9gGjfxdEDfG5UxpXJlIMvo 429
nnpf/problems/willmore/__init__.py sha256=i2VWh-2QsIMffF3hxqU-ZK5Y0iauO1QH_PKV2CWnDCU 69
nnpf/problems/willmore/datasets.py sha256=Bat8CGCdnDdQy_vVZaToBkGnGkhg8VdcwO8DWXCiSqI 1001
nnpf/problems/willmore/problem.py sha256=8XZ_1vjPctRc2pLlv2rL8j3Ffy2zkSjT46sv1YXc3oM 1585
nnpf/problems/willmore/utils.py sha256=Av6jbRkUOa36fn1Lg0FLLxBBfknyypqDonyZRSBbd3M 432
nnpf/shapes/__init__.py sha256=IT8mO08n_aJ4Z7VfaXY7lwvTaJ_JgG7sDkC3Bk1680Q 2628
nnpf/shapes/operators.py sha256=ZfRsVTKIKMbLhgPqgANMflwAwaV0MACJ9WfkgI4GdAg 14283
nnpf/shapes/shapes.py sha256=ku0zUMwjOpYVnHuvy_IjYP0NVqrRBvd5swp9vv-nsXY 20536
nnpf/shapes/slices.py sha256=du3QOkxiS2xQ1_nxn1QJHSuCpLU4MWiniPRGyKpZnrw 6603
nnpf/shapes/utils.py sha256=Dx9nWj3_dSBtyrpQUyZ6twQKNHPdl2jU6cFH63eIA8c 2207
nnpf/trainer/__init__.py sha256=ROWHztSu-abN9jpsl2Vqmg_Euo6G4nE9ByFOsqC_7Ls 24
nnpf/trainer/trainer.py sha256=PCrWt3L71ldfUFdWZ4F3X_15o9I6RulO2sEghzUv7Wk 6950
nnpf/utils/__init__.py sha256=DNKFCx5X1TsLWjq252ryHCJvRaeispx_ZPAo2zgew8I 44
nnpf/utils/inspect.py sha256=fMzkn-SmtEs6FMJ-IbU2UmpURft4u77sfsFDqy2imdk 6645
nnpf/utils/path.py sha256=GH3ZNhlEoHhmMIARYkQN4lPuZZWoiTJOcoQhG5MAXSI 1667
nnpf/visu/__init__.py sha256=YdRmnlvE3RTaoZqs5X1AufyfSBboGyddg7q23vGL_gQ 20
nnpf/visu/visu.py sha256=NYxRKQvp0Z94ejQeBGHN4vsQTyWghHL1jU3pAOClbtM 14852
nnpf-1.0.2.dist-info/LICENSE.md sha256=wQRQBrU-hxKyXeXuDmLYSRwaZFxOIfOjB9Br8E25Mkc 1118
nnpf-1.0.2.dist-info/METADATA sha256=u0Oh6kDF2vtr5y1WYrUBD0puvIrLBNuxaJcPYMLSg0k 6062
nnpf-1.0.2.dist-info/WHEEL sha256=OVMc5UfuAQiSplgO0_WdW7vXVGAt9Hdd6qtN4HotdyA 91
nnpf-1.0.2.dist-info/entry_points.txt sha256=T27Xyda6cFDg5GG6xHWITYhKYWnJfQgD_BBHdhiV9ns 42
nnpf-1.0.2.dist-info/top_level.txt sha256=lpzIv-hydzs4z0AIHZKAv3rF1gbYw6xEL0QkYUeXeoo 5
nnpf-1.0.2.dist-info/RECORD

top_level.txt

nnpf

entry_points.txt

nnpf = nnpf.cmd:actions